問題タブ [android-tablelayout]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票する
2 に答える
2398 参照

android - ScrollView は TableLayout 全体を表示しません

TableLayout内に を表示したいScrollView。テーブルには 9TableRowがありScrollViewますが、4 番目の行の一部が表示され始め、上にスクロールして行を表示することはできません。

XML レイアウト:

whereのTableRows は、uyi_choosepi_tablelayout次のようにプログラムで追加されます。

ヒントをいただければ幸いです。

0 投票する
2 に答える
4025 参照

android - テーブルの行を正確に 3 つの部分に分割するにはどうすればよいですか?

テーブル レイアウトのテーブル行のボタン パーツの XML コードを次に示します。

定数 dip を入力せずに、これらのボタンを 3 つに均等に分割するにはどうすればよいでしょうか。しかし、私は体重を実験するのに運がありませんでした.

0 投票する
1 に答える
973 参照

android - TableLayout では、行を並べ替えることができますか? または、SQLite を使用する必要がありますか?

(TableLayout)以下に示すように、さまざまな連絡先への通話に使用された分数を示す表を作成しました。

使用時間の降順になるように行を並べ替えられるようにしたいと考えています。最初に SQLite を使用してテーブルをデータベースにしないと、これは可能ですか? 私は今日までそれを使用したことがありません。非常に単純なはずのことを、非常に長い道のりのように思えます。

必要に応じて、テーブルの作成に使用するコードを投稿できます。

0 投票する
1 に答える
34112 参照

android - Androidでテーブル列を設定する方法

テーブル行(テキストビューを含む)のレイアウトパラメータを設定するのに問題があります。

良いレイアウトを得るためにいくつかの列を追加したいと思います。私はそれを動的にやっています。(コード内)

これらの2つのテキストビューを2つの列にし、それに応じて画面上にレイアウトしたいと思います。

0 投票する
1 に答える
2840 参照

android - AndroidのTableLayoutのテーブル列

AndroidのTableLayoutに列を追加できるかどうか誰かが知っていますか?テーブル内に比較的大量のデータを表示する必要があります。明らかに、これはすべて1つの列に表示されるべきではありません。

TableRow()-Objectを作成することにより、行を追加できます。さらに、いくつかのxmlパラメータがありますが、Javaコードを介してアクセスする方法がわかりません。

TableRow.LayoutParamsで一致する値を見つけることができませんでした。しかし、おそらく私はそれを間違った方法で使用しようとしました。

0 投票する
2 に答える
1160 参照

android - Android : TableLayout を適切に設定できません

アクティビティで DB からのデータを表示しています。下部にテーブルとボタンが必要です。データの場合、 TableLayout が最適なオプションになると考えられていました。TableLayout を Horizo​​ntalView と ScrollView に追加して、垂直方向と水平方向にスクロールできるようにしました。ヘッダーを含むすべての行を動的に追加しています。この部分は正常に動作しています。

コンテンツが画面幅よりも小さい場合でも、画面幅全体を占める必要があります。たとえば。テーブルがポートレート モードにうまく収まる場合、もちろんランドスケープ モードでは右側に空白が残ります。そのスペースが空っぽになるのではなく、すべての列が占めるようにしたくありません。行幅が画面幅よりも大きい場合、水平スクロールバーが表示されるため、まったく問題はありません。

いくつかのバリエーションを試しましたが、何も役に立ちませんでした。すべてのスペースを利用するためにどのような設定を行うべきか(avblがあれば)、それを表示するアイデア。

はい、水平スクロールバーのもう 1 つの問題は、最後の行に表示されます。最後の行の下に表示したいので、最後の行の境界線が表示されます。私のXML:

出力: ここに画像の説明を入力

0 投票する
2 に答える
1813 参照

android - AndroidでのTableLayoutの動的更新

こんにちは!この TableLayout があり、作成後に画面が空になります。行数と列数は手動で指定する仕様のため、xmlファイルはありません。まず、k <= 行および l <= 列の座標 (k, l) にボタンを追加する場合は、このソリューションを使用する必要があるため、空の 1 x 1 の表示されない TextView-s でテーブルを埋める必要があります。コードは次のとおりです。

ListView は私の問題の解決策にはなりません。

問題は、画面に何も映っていないことです。

答えてくれてありがとう: ゲリ

0 投票する
1 に答える
4637 参照

android - TableLayoutにandroid:layout_weightをプログラムで入力します

テーブルレイアウトにセルと行ストレッチを入力して画面全体に表示しようとしています。このような:

http://imageshack.us/photo/my-images/69/device20120201005942.png/

Eclipseのグラフィカルレイアウトウィンドウで設計されたこのレイアウトは、私が望むものを提供します(android:layout_weightは垂直方向のストレッチを解決します):

コード内で同じ外観を作成しようとしていますが、これまでのところ失敗しました。これが私のアクティビティのoncreateです:

ImageViewの重力を設定するコードがありませんが、この試みによりクラッシュが発生します。

このコードにより、3つの行が作成され、それぞれが水平方向に伸びますが、垂直方向には伸びません。

http://imageshack.us/photo/my-images/835/gridc.png/

ここで欠けているものが見つかりません。また、デザイナーでテーブル行を準備し、実行時にテーブルを膨らませて追加しようとしましたが、結果は変わりませんでした。

それで、どういうわけか、私はエディターで作成できるのと同じレイアウトをプログラムで取得したいと思います。

助けてください!

0 投票する
1 に答える
4058 参照

android - プログラムによる Android 相対レイアウト

基本的に、テーブルに行を追加しようとしています。これをプログラムで行う必要があります。

必要なコンテンツを追加することはできますが、希望どおりにはできません。

たとえば、左側にテキストビュー、右側にボタン edittext ボタンが必要です。

基本的には下の画像のようにしたい:

.

また、テキストビューの幅だけにしたくありません。

とにかく、ここに私がこれまでに作ったものがあります:

XML:

ジャワ:

私は検索などを試みましたが、まだ正しく動作させることができません..どんな助けでも大歓迎です!

0 投票する
3 に答える
3462 参照

android - 2 行で右揃えの Android テーブル レイアウトの問題

Android のレイアウトに問題があります。作成しようとしているのは、次のようなものです。

「image1」と2を一緒にしたいのですが。いずれかの方法、

Androidで使用しているレイアウトは次のとおりです。

また、ImageViews 自体に android:layout_gravity:"right" を配置しようとしましたが、何もしませんでした。

何らかの理由で、この Android レイアウトは常にラベルをインデントし (列にまたがることはありません)、2 行目に右揃えすることはありません。何が間違っているのかわかりません。これは Android 2.1 です。誰でも知っていますか?